Reviewing this week’s top TV show was a difficult task, despite the fact that I completely loved it. It was made by a short-lived Netflix-style platform called Seeso (owned by Comcast), which launched in January 2016 and closed in November 2017. If you haven’t heard of Flowers, the platform’s unlucky demise is the reason.
